Python. The difference in hours and minutes is 1 * 24 + 9 hours and 17 minutes.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Python | Creating a Pandas dataframe column based on a given condition, Selecting rows in pandas DataFrame based on conditions, Get all rows in a Pandas DataFrame containing given substring, Python | Find position of a character in given string, replace() in Python to replace a substring, Python | Replace substring in list of strings, Python – Replace Substrings from String List, How to get column names in Pandas dataframe, Python program to convert a list to string, Reading and Writing to text files in Python, Different ways to create Pandas Dataframe. def days_between(d1, d2):... days * 24 * 3600 + timedelta. How to convert an integer into a date object in Python? We can have the following components in datetime: The time class. One can store the date class objects into the list using append() method. python days between two dates. Found insideI would like to determine how many days past the New Year. ... it enters the while loop ((today-nyd).days) gives the difference between a current date and ... The datetime module provides classes for manipulating dates and times. ticks = time.time() print "Number of ticks since 12:00am, January 1, 1970:", ticks. Sample Solution: Python Code: from datetime import datetime, time def date_diff_in_Seconds( dt2, dt1): timedelta = dt2 - dt1 return timedelta. days * 24 * 3600 + timedelta. Yeah! Python get Weekday Name from Weekday Value, Python difference between two dates in days, Python difference between two dates in months, Python difference between two dates in minutes, Python difference between two dates in seconds, Python difference between two dates in weeks, Getting the date of 7 days ago from current date in Python. Found inside – Page 460echo "We are in the month = $(date +%B)" # Difference between %A and %a is, ... name. echo "Current Day of the week = $(date +%A)" echo "Current Day of the ... class datetime. Output. Let’s see how to calculate the difference between two dates in years using PySpark SQL example. First_Day and Last_Day. The returned number ranges between 1 and 7, where 1 corresponds to Sunday, 2 - to Monday, and so on. It is very easy to do date and time maths in Python using time delta objects. Found insideLearn to Develop Efficient Programs using Python Mohit Raj ... Let's see the syntax of timedelta: datetime.timedelta(days=0, seconds=0, microseconds=0, ... For example, the time span for ‘W’ (week) is exactly 7 times longer than the time span for ‘D’ (day), and the time span for ‘D’ (day) is exactly 24 times longer than the time span for ‘h’ (hour). Found inside – Page 511.15 Tutorial Steps to Use Calendar Widget and Date Edit To learn these widgets, ... date along with the date needed by the user, with the only difference ... The following tool visualize what the computer is doing step-by-step as it executes the said program: Have another way to solve this solution? Explanation. Sample Solution: Python Code: from datetime import datetime, time def date_diff_in_Seconds( dt2, dt1): timedelta = dt2 - dt1 return timedelta. All arguments are optional and default to 0. Arguments may be integers, in the following ranges: If an argument outside those ranges is given, ValueError is raised. By default, it compare the current and previous row, and you can also specify the period argument in order to compare the … This is a very simple python code snippet for calculating the difference between two dates or timestamps. Write a Python program to print the following 'here document'. Code #1 : Basic. After the two time strings are stored with their time format, the time interval between the two is calculated by simply subtracting the two variables. Write a Python program to calculate two date difference in seconds. Python Datetime: Exercise-36 with Solution. Finding difference in Timestamps – Python Pandas. python3 dates between two dates. date1.month - date2.month returns -2; 12*(date1.year - date2.year) returns 12-2 + 12 = 10; Important Point Suppose you want to calculate the number of months between 31/10/2018 and 01/11/2018, the above suggested method will return 1 as two dates lie in a month difference. 2021-02-02 11:10:48. from datetime import datetime, timedelta def date_range ( start, end ): delta = end - start # as timedelta days = [ start + timedelta ( days =i) for i in range (delta.days + 1 )] return days start_date = datetime ( 2008, 8, 1 ) end_date = datetime ( 2008, 8, 3 ) print (date_range (start_date, end_date)) python get difference between two dates in minutes. Similarly, we subtract the datetime.year attribute of one datetimes from the other datetimes and then, multiply the result by 12 to get the difference in months. Python add six months to current date. Convert datetime object to a String of date only in Python, Python get yesterday's date in this format MMDDYY. … Found inside – Page 309Instances of class datetime support some arithmetic: the difference between datetime ... datetime(year,month,day,hour=0,minute=0,second=0, microsecond=0 ... What is the difficulty level of this exercise? Scala Programming Exercises, Practice, Solution. I expect that the days would be integers. Click me to see the solution. d1 = date(2013,1... You can subtract a day from a python date using the timedelta object. You need to create a timedelta object with the amount of time you want to subtract. Then subtract it from the date. This will give the output − You can also subtract years, months, hours, etc. in the same way from a date using the timedelta object. I tried reading the python docs but did not understand the concept of delta object and how can I measure the difference in terms of days between two dates. Python get current date time without microsecond. how can I extract the difference between two dates in terms of day using the delta object? How to find week of the year from specific date in Python? Live Demo. Found insideWeekday of the week: 1 Day of year: 210 Day of the month : 29 Day of week: Monday ... to a date, and also how to calculate the difference between two dates. python get difference between two dates in minutes. Golang mloshali Output: CURRENT DAY : 2020-12-27 OLD Date : 2020-12-10. Sample Solution: Python Code : Python change Paris time into New York time. Found inside – Page 13Use time() method to extract date from dt2. ... print(f'Time difference: {td1}') We get the following output: Time difference: 5 days, 0:00:00 3. To begin with, your interview preparations Enhance your Data Structures concepts with the Python DS Course. Pandas timestamp differences returns a datetime.timedelta object. The most basic way to create datetimes is from strings in ISO 8601 date or datetime format. Found inside – Page 99We can do this with the datediff function that will return the number of days in ... in Python from pyspark.sql.functions import datediff, months_between, ... How to create a DateTime equal to 15 minutes ago? That's convenient. First line calculates the difference between two dates. relativedelta (date_2, date_1) This object stores the hour, minute, second, microsecond, and tzinfo (time zone information). The difference compared to the previous one is that we are giving as “from datetime” to get the current date and time while importing the module.A variable val1 holds the current date and time.. Another variable, val2, holds the date … SQL Server: -- Difference between Dec 29, 2011 23:00 and Dec 31, 2011 01:00 in days SELECT DATEDIFF (day, '2011-12-29 23:00:00', '2011-12-31 01:00:00'); -- Result: 2. Found inside – Page 423To specify the frequency of the timestamps (which defaults to one day), ... we can give both starting and ending points as date and time strings (or ... For a quick view, you can see the sample data output as per below: Solutions: Option 1: Using Series or Data Frame diff. I tried reading the python docs but did not understand the concept of delta object and how can I measure the difference in terms of days between two dates. Found inside – Page 106As we said before, the datasets contain daily observations for multiple parameters, along with the date of observations • Difference for one day is grouped ... Start=date (2019,7,1) End=date (2019,8,15) Start=date (2019,7,1) End=date (2019,8,15) 3. How do I get the day of week from given date in Python. Example: import datetime epochtime = 30256871 datetime = datetime.datetime.fromtimestamp (epochtime) print (datetime) In this example I have imported the datetime package and taken the variable as epoch time and value to the variable like the … Found inside – Page 166Because datetime expects integers, this code converts all of our data to integers. The order datetime expects data in is year, month, day, hour, minute, ... To find the difference between two dates in form of minutes, the attribute seconds of timedelta object can be used which can be further divided by 60 to convert to minutes. MINYEAR is 1. Found inside – Page 136Now let's find out what day it is: > X > datetime. date. today () datetime. ... understand the difference between this object and the datetime.date object. Then click Number > Decimal places: 2. Do as IDLE asks, obey IDLE! seconds #Specified date date1 = datetime. And to begin with your Machine Learning Journey, join the Machine Learning – Basic Level Course. Aryan. date2=date (y,m,d) delta=date2-date1. #!/usr/bin/python import time; # This is required to include time module. The length of the span is the range of a 64-bit integer times the length of the date or unit. Python add N number of seconds to specific date time. generate link and share the link here. How do I convert a datetime object to date object in Python? Code: Python. The time difference in seconds 93178.482513. Found inside – Page 78... 40000, 50000]' 3.1.1 Converting Strings to Date Time in Python from datetime ... Time difference of -1203358055 secs difftime(adob2,mydob2,units=“days”) ... Contribute your code (and comments) through Disqus. I tried the code posted by larsmans above but, there are a couple of problems: 1) The code as is will throw the error as mentioned by mauguerra In the below Python program, it will take three parameters, 1st is the start date, 2nd is the end date, and the third is default specified the day numbers 6 and 7, for Saturday and Sundays.. import datetime def workdays(d, end, excluded=(6, 7)): days = [] while d.date() <= end.date(): if d.isoweekday() not in excluded: days.append(d) d += datetime.timedelta(days… This would produce a result something as follows −. Second line converts the difference in terms of days (timedelta64 (1,’D’)- D indicates days) view source print? One of the best ways to sort a group of dates is to store them into a list and apply sort() method. As you can see, we have easily calculated difference between two datetime objects. I tried a couple of codes, but end up using something as simple as (in Python 3): from datetime import datetime You could write a function to convert the user input from string to date. Found inside – Page 245#Get current date spark.sql("select current_date()").show() #add days ... (Current date - current date+2 months) spark.sql("select datediff(current_date(), ... 1. df ['diff_days'] = df ['End_date'] - df ['Start_date'] 2. df ['diff_days']=df ['diff_days']/np.timedelta64 (1,'D') … It accepts a variant date and returns the number of the week day that corresponds to it. df['difference_in_datetime'] = abs(... spark. get time between two datetime python. How to get the last Sunday and Saturday date in Python? By using our site, you Here are the date units: Comparing dates is quite easy in Python. Found inside – Page 291Types in datetime module Type Description date Store calendar date (year, ... time timedelta Represents the difference between two datetime values (as days, ... Sample Output 1. You can also use the timedelta method under the DateTime module to convert seconds into the preferred format. Simple to find difference between two dates our expected output would be example! Tzinfo ( time zone information ) can store the date or datetime instances to! Out the time being Python timedelta is representing the duration of the year, month, nanos... Is to store them into a list and apply sort ( ) function and is... Measure in the example above it is so simple to find the difference in terms of number of in! Year number allowed in a date using the delta object best industry experts python date difference in days,! Tool visualize what the computer is doing step-by-step as it executes the program... Stored in two variables using the delta means average of difference and so output. What the computer is doing step-by-step as it executes the said program: have way! Learning Journey, join the Machine Learning – Basic Level Course are closing our commenting system for the time.. In Python that represents the difference operation to your time series if there is only 1 day and 2 between... Get weekday of specific date in string format to Unix timestamp from week number in Python store! Can have the following 'here document ' zone information ) that helps us to solve solution!, a date … what is the difference between two dates is to subtract the timedelta under...: 7186862.73399 using the delta means average of difference and so the duration of the attributes of an of... Strings are stored in two variables using the time column the results returned simulate what you would have seen that!, weeks, ‘ y ’ for day, hour, minute from current date Completions and cloudless.... In between two datetime objects will return the difference operation to your time series data Python. Weekday of specific date in Python using time delta object represents a duration, the difference between two dates expected... To begin with your Machine Learning – Basic Level Course apply sort ( ) always... Volume of a measure us see with the help of datetime modules measure the! The one you started earlier: > > time_now.year all you have to do date and Last date of python date difference in days... … this is a combination of a week from given date radius 6 W ’ for year this! Difftime ( ) check whether an object is of type datetime.date that % H %... `` 33 hours 17 minutes '' to subtract featured, learn and code with the amount of time you to! That % H, % M and % s are the representatives hours... Out the time class from strings in ISO 8601 date or unit that you define with.date ). Range you wish days we use datediff ( ) function ‘ y ’ for day, ‘ ’. Library ) and dateutil.relativedelta.relativedelta when working only with days and end of date current! January 1, 1970: '', ticks the datetime.strptime ( ).... Is very easy to do date and Last date of current Quarter use. Next: write a Python program to get the volume of a.! Required to include time module is 1 * 24 + 9 hours and minutes 1! And methods that can be numerous applications that require processing dates and format... Library ) and dateutil.relativedelta.relativedelta when working only with days current day is weekday or in... Us a datetime equal to 15 minutes ago is created by subtracting the and. It in most cases compare the values between the two dates in Python module is very to. Csv file with columns date, time.I want to subtract comes with an inbuilt datetime module to the. Interested in finding a characteristic prior to today transform for time series data with Python values. Have seen with that filter on the given dates are: 323 days the user input from string UTC. Pandas equivalent of Python ’ s see how to write a function to deal with dates and times and., first import python date difference in days the Kite plugin for your code ( and comments ) through.... More date values different types of dates and times industry experts you need to use... Produce a result something as follows: Python comes with an inbuilt datetime module to convert into. Given, ValueError is raised our servers and financial constraints, we need to also use abs ( ). Data and time way to compare dates with the Kite plugin for your code and! ) method refer to specific values of a week from given date code but 's! Object to string using strftime ( ) method object to date dates between two dates, and! You define with.date ( ) print `` number of the number of ticks since 12:00am, January,... Same year, month and day timedelta objects and dates that you define with (... Range you wish Commons Attribution-NonCommercial-ShareAlike 3.0 Unported License compared using comparison operators ( like, < =,! etc. Instances, to the microsecond resolution Last date of week from a specified date a! Wrote the following 'here document ' time intervals with same year, month, ‘ nanosecond ’, y! Would be: example: input: Date_1 = 10/09/2023, Date_2 = 04/02/2025 difference the... Would produce a result something as follows − as argument to find week of the year specific! Learn and code with the help of datetime module: Python comes with inbuilt! R in days using the timedelta method under the datetime object to using. The datetime.date object moment in time, if input is an integer into a date is very! For time series format to Unix timestamp in R in days using Python datetime module is very easy do! Understand the timedelta class which is present in the same way from a specified date a! Related problems with days the duration expresses the difference in days we use datediff ( ) function is... Of just the year, month, day, ‘ W ’ for weeks, ‘ y for., < = number of days between two dates in Python, Python get yesterday 's,. Of ticks since 12:00am, January 1, 1970: 7186862.73399 duration of python date difference in days. Format using datetime module that helps us to solve various datetime related problems two numbers class stores the difference timestamps... Find difference between two dates over a given date of the attributes an! Under a Creative Commons Attribution-NonCommercial-ShareAlike 3.0 Unported License servers and financial constraints, we to. ’ s way of understanding and dealing with python date difference in days data, we will discuss how get! An object of type datetime.datetime to datetime two numbers a combination of a with! And time maths in Python range of dates and times Saturday date string. It is so simple to find current day is weekday or weekends in?! After from the datetime object get access to ad-free content, doubt assistance more! That corresponds to it M and % s are the representatives of hours, etc. ) second. Widely used data transform for time series data with Python Learning Journey, join the Machine Learning Journey join. First date and time intervals time.I want to use… months_between ( '2019-07-01 ' current_date. Console session carries on from the one you started earlier: > > > > > > time_now.year incorrect number! Function takes days as argument to find the difference between two dates in years PySpark... Interchangeable with it in most cases a class in datetime module is as follows: Python to. Time stamps positive or negative by subtracting the last_day and First_day which returns the difference in –! Offset ' and 'days ago ' the said program: have another way to compare values! Is weekday or weekends in Python, it is so simple to find current day is weekday or weekends Python. D ” returns the number of function to calculate two date,,. You want to find the difference between two dates Python the largest year allowed! Or floats, and the previous rows W ’ for year Monday 's date datetime! Days we use datediff ( ) print `` number of days between python date difference in days,...: 2020-12-27 OLD date: 2020-12-10 microsecond resolution datediff ( ) W ’ for month, and the end of! Can see, the difference in timestamps – Python Pandas ( from Python ’ s and... Day that corresponds to Sunday, 2 - to Monday, and seconds elapsed since the epoch Structures. Class and methods that can be numerous applications that require processing dates times! Get double-digit months and years simple to find current day: 2020-12-27 date! Year from a date in Python, it is 0 minutes, and seconds elapsed since the epoch may integers... … what is timedelta in Python, date, time.I want to find the number of days between two in. The link here any date range you wish epoch to datetime round ( months_between ( '2019-07-01 ', current_date ). Equivalent of Python ’ s way of understanding and dealing with date data, we often want to two. ) finding difference in the list using append ( ) function ‘ y for... Is dealt with by using timedelta, you will discover how to apply the difference between two dates Python! Months, hours, minutes and, seconds that you define with.date ( print. Is representing the duration of the span is the range of a 64-bit integer times the length of the between! Month in Python time module microsecond resolution discuss how to find difference between two dates, you also. Second, microsecond, and the end date of week from a specified date in this tutorial, will!
Rush Hospital Meridian, Ms Closing, How To Change App Icons Android Without Launcher, Directions To Paul Brown Stadium, Wooden Corner Shelf Lamp, Chris Carson Fantasy Name, Festival Of Laughs Ticketmaster, Santorini To Mykonos Flight,